It is looking really good. I really like the station and the bridge that leads to it. I would be careful though to not use those wooden rails that you have as the roof, too much. I see them in three of these screens.

 

On the floorless (or should I say Dive?) coaster, the supports on the Dive loop are a bit off. First if you want to use the vertical rectangular design (like you have here) then maybe take some of the flanged pieces off, because they dont need that many. Also mabye consider making the flanges the same color as the rest of the support. Most coaster supports have flages the color of the pipe.

 

If you wanted to go with a different type of support to give it more realism (which I would), you could use the diagonal supports and connect it lower on the Half loop piece. Kind of like...

http://cache.rcdb.com/pictures/picmax/p18436.jpg

^See how they are not vertical?

 

Also, do you plan on supporting that train bridge? Or is that sitting right on the water?

 

Anyway, keep up the good work!
